Originally released in 1982. Squizzy Taylor is a crime/drama film. directed by Kevin James Dobson.

Starring David Atkins, Jacki Weaver, and Alan Cassell

Synopsis

This Australian crime drama chronicles the life of notorious, keen witted, acid tongued 1920s Melbourne gangster Squizzy Taylor. Wormy and diminutive, yet cunning and determined small-time hoodlum Squizzy Taylor rises to prominence and popularity in Melbourne, Australia in the 1920's. Squizzy romances brash moll Dolly and works for bookie Henry Stokes before branching out on his own while being hounded by the police and courted by the press the whole time.
